Course Content

• Introduction to Molecular Ecology & Population Genetics
• Molecular Markers in Population Ecology (Microsatellites, SNPs, etc.)
• Population Genetic Analysis: Hardy-Weinberg Equilibrium and Departures
• Landscape Genetics & Spatial Analysis (GIS)
• Phylogeography and Evolutionary History
• Conservation Genetics and Management
• Molecular Ecology of Invasive Species
• Quantitative Genetics and its application to ecology
• Data Analysis and Bioinformatics for Molecular Ecology (R, Bioconductor)
• Designing and implementing Molecular Ecology studies

Career Role (Molecular & Population Ecology) Description
Conservation Scientist (Molecular Ecology, Population Genetics) Applies molecular techniques to study endangered species populations, informing conservation strategies. High demand in UK wildlife trusts and government agencies.
Research Scientist (Population Ecology) (Population Dynamics, Modelling) Conducts research on population dynamics, using statistical modelling and ecological principles. Opportunities in universities, research institutes, and government bodies.
Environmental Consultant (Molecular Ecology) (DNA analysis, Biodiversity assessments) Utilizes molecular ecology methods for environmental impact assessments and biodiversity monitoring. Strong demand across private consulting firms.
Data Scientist (Population Genetics) (Bioinformatics, Statistical analysis) Analyzes large genomic datasets, drawing inferences about population structure and evolution. Growing demand across the biotechnology and pharmaceutical sectors.
